It is kind of funny. I've had a C&R 07 FFL for 15 years and have purchased two rifles with it, both Russian Tula SKS'.
For me the attraction of the C&R was really the fact that in California, up until recently (when Kamala Harris decided to give her biased opinion that is NOT law) we could couple the C&R with the state's COE (certificate of eligibility) to be exempt from the 1 new handgun every 30 days law.
